The Dynamics of Grace: Presenting Ourselves to God (and not to Sin)

We are told in Scripture to not "present" ourselves to Sin to be brought back under its lordship but to "present" ourselves to God.  It also says that to whomever we present ourselves that act becomes transforming...either for good or bad.  This is an important daily reality for Christians...but "thanks be to God" that we are under the "reign of Grace"!!
